In this premium video tutorial, Pro Tools Expert team member Julian Rodgers demonstrates three useful features of Pro Tools which become important when clips overlap on the timeline and several other related options:

Layered Editing Mode

A simple new feature, introduced in Pro Tools 12.6 which suspends the usual Pro Tools behaviour of trimming underlying clips when a clip gets placed on top.

Send Fully Overlapped Clips To Available Playlist While Editing

This setting protects sequences of clips from being accidentally overwritten while dragging clips on top of them.

Send To Back/Bring To Front

A useful feature while nudging, quickly swap the position of overlapping clips.
